We are currently recruiting for a Cook to join our team based at our CAFRE Loughry, Cookstown site. This is a great opportunity to join a world leading facilities management company.

Working Pattern: 34 Hours per Week

  • Monday - Thursday 07:30am - 15:30pm
  • Friday 07:30am - 11:30am

Term Time role

Rewards:

  • 20 days' paid holidays (pro-rata)
  • Training & Development
  • Uniform & on-shift meals provided
  • Company Pension Scheme
  • Employee Health and Wellbeing and Employee Assistance Program
  • Voluntary Health and Cash plan Healthcare Scheme

The Role:

  • Operating the kitchen focusing on tasty, well-balanced, nutritious meals catering for all dietary requirements.
  • Ensuring the efficient and effective delivery of services to the client organisation in accordance with the agreement of the contract.
  • Have full responsibility for all aspects of the service and team whilst on shift.
  • Ensuring all bookwork is completed within agreed timescales and company requirements.
  • Ensuring all HACCP, Food Safety, and Health & Safety Legislation requirements are always adhered to.

The Person:

  • Attention to detail in all aspects of the work.
  • Leads by example and lives our values.
  • Enthusiastic and passionate about our customer service and reputation.
  • Self-motivated, working independently and on own initiative.
  • Flexible with a positive, can-do attitude.
  • Excellent communication, organisational, and time management skills.
  • Ability to ensure a safe environment is maintained in compliance with health, safety, fire, hygiene, and security legislation and company policies and procedures.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ment, deal with issues as they arise and contribute in all areas of running a kitchen and providing a great food service.

How to prepare for a job interview at Mount Charles

Show Your People Skills

In hospitality, customer service is everything! Be ready to showcase examples of how you've engaged with customers positively. Maybe you turned a tough situation around or went that extra mile for a guest—let’s hear those stories!

Know Your Menu Inside Out

Expect some technical questions about food and drink, especially if you're applying for a kitchen or service role. Brush up on the menu items, including ingredients and any potential allergens. If you’ve got any favourite dishes or cocktails, have a little something prepared to discuss, too!

Demonstrate Your Team Spirit

Hospitality thrives on teamwork, so think of examples where you've worked well with others in a fast-paced environment. Be prepared to discuss what makes a great team member and how you contribute to a positive working vibe. They’re looking for that 'good fit!'

Get Ready for a Practical Test

In full-time food service roles, don’t be surprised if they want to see your skills in action. Whether it's serving a table or prepping a dish, be mentally prepared for a practical test during the interview. Practice makes perfect—a little dry run with friends could give you the edge!
